Their enormous size makes it much easier for green anacondas to swim in the water than to slither slowly on land. The green anaconda is native to South America, making its home in swamps, marshes and streams. The green anaconda, with a girth of nearly 30 cm (12 in.) and a weight of 227 kg (550 lb.), is the heaviest of all snakes. Anacondas are great swimmers and often hunt for prey in rivers and swamps. The anaconda’s scientific name is Eunectes murinus, and it is the heaviest snake in the world, reaching lengths of up to 30 feet (9 meters). The alligator-like anaconda is a large, non-venomous snake found in tropical South America. If you measured around the middle of an anaconda's body, it could be up to 12 inches around-measure your thigh to compare. Weighing up to 550 pounds, it holds the record for heaviest snake in the world.
